Metering

Metering Positive Displacement Pumps. These positive displacement pumps move liquids at adjustable flow rates which are precise when averaged over time. Metering refers to this process, and refers to the pump’s application, rather than the kind of pump used. Positive displacement pumps are often used as metering pumps to pump chemicals, solutions, or other liquids, and are able to pump into a high discharge pressure. These pumps are commonly driven by an electric motor.
